The German Approach: Where Tradition Meets Strict Regulation
Unlike in many other countries where natural items are regulated strictly as dietary supplements or food items, Germany views certain organic items through a much more stringent lens. The Federal Institute for Drugs and Medical Devices (Bundesinstitut für Arzneimittel und Medizinprodukte, NahrungsergäNzungsmittel Online Kaufen Deutschland or BfArM) oversees these items.
In Germany, organic preparations are typically categorized into unique categories:
- Traditional Herbal Medicinal Products (Traditionelle pflanzliche Arzneimittel): These need registration and needs to have a history of safe use covering at least 30 years, consisting of a minimum of 15 years within the European Union.
- Well-Established Medicinal Products: These need strenuous clinical dossiers showing both effectiveness and safety, similar to traditional synthetic drugs.
- Food Supplements (Nahrungsergänzungsmittel): These are managed more similarly to foods and are implied to supplement typical nutritional consumption instead of treat specific ailments.
This extensive oversight suggests customers in Germany can acquire herbal items with a high degree of confidence regarding their purity, strength, and security.

Popular Herbal Supplements in Germany
German consumers lean heavily toward evidence-based phytotherapy. Specific herbs have achieved renowned status in German medication and are often advised by standard medical doctors (Ärzte).
| Common Name (English) | German Name | Primary Traditional Uses | Type Commonly Found |
|---|---|---|---|
| St. John's Wort | Johanniskraut | Moderate to moderate anxiety, mood stabilization | Tablets, Capsules, Tea |
| Ginkgo Biloba | Ginkgo | Supporting cognitive function, memory, and blood flow | Film-coated tablets, Liquid extract |
| Milk Thistle | Mariendistel | Liver health, AppetitzüGler Deutschland detoxification assistance | Pills, Softgels |
| Devil's Claw | Teufelskralle | Joint pain, neck and back pain, and musculoskeletal pain | Tablets, Ointments |
| Valerian Root | Baldrian | Sleep conditions, stress and anxiety, anxious restlessness | Drops, Capsules, Sleep teas |
| Thyme/ Ivy Blend | Efeu-Thymian | Coughs, bronchitis, and breathing blockage | Cough syrups (Saft) |
Secret Benefits of the German Herbal Market
Selecting to integrate herbal supplements within the German market offers a number of unique advantages:
- Standardization: German phytopharmaceuticals are typically standardized. This means every dosage includes a guaranteed, precise quantity of the active constituent (e.g., a particular portion of ginkgo-flavonglycosides).
- Integration with Conventional Medicine: It is completely normal in Germany for a medical physician to compose a prescription (grünes Rezept or green prescription, meaning the patient pays of pocket, but the doctor suggests it) for a herbal remedy like St. John's Wort or Butterbur.
- High Environmental Standards: Due to stringent EU regulations and consumer demand, lots of German natural brands prioritize organic farming, sustainable wild-harvesting, and environment-friendly product packaging.
Essential Considerations and Safety Tips
While natural products are generally considered safe, "natural" does not instantly indicate "complimentary of negative effects." Herbal solutions can be remarkably powerful and can interact adversely with prescription medications.
Tips for Safe Usage:
- Consult a Professional: Always speak to an Apotheker or doctor before starting a new organic regimen, specifically if you are taking blood slimmers, birth control, or antidepressants.
- Look For St. John's Wort: Johanniskraut is infamous for decreasing the efficacy of lots of medications, including contraceptive pills and immunosuppressants.
- Examine the Label: Look for specific terms like Arzneidpflanze (medical plant grade) if you are seeking therapeutic advantages rather than basic nutritional assistance.
- Understand Insurance Coverage: Statutory health insurance (gesetzliche Krankenversicherung) in Germany normally does not cover non-prescription over-the-counter supplements, even if they are natural medicines, though exceptions sometimes exist for kids or particular chronic conditions.
